We arrived by plane from Bogota to Leticia, the capital of the Amazon province in Colombia. Here Colombia has a border with Brazil and Peru. It's a three way border over the Amazon. So in one day we "traveled" in all three countries. In the morning we were in Leticia, Colombia and after breakfast we crossed over to Santa Rosa, Peru in order to arrange our trip up the Amazon in a slow boat. At night we had dinner at a restaurant in Tabatinga, Brazil and then we came back to Leticia for our last night in Colombia.
In order to go to Santa Rosa we had to hire a small boat and cross the Amazon. But go to Tabatinga you can simply walk. It's just like goging to a different neighbourhood of the same town. There is no border check or anything like that.
